WebAug 20, 2024 · Vitamin K2, which is predominantly produced by bacteria, is further divided into subgroups named MK4 to MK13. these are found in some dairy products, pork, poultry and fermented foods. Vitamin K2 may have more of a protective effect on bone than vitamin K1. However, deficiencies of both K1 and K2 appear to have a negative effect. WebOct 21, 2024 · Which vitamins should be taken together? In general, water-soluble vitamins can be taken together without food, and fat-soluble vitamins can be taken together with food containing healthy fats. The following combinations of supplements may actually be more effective when combined.
